American Foundation for Firearm Injury Reduction in Medicine is a small nonprofit that reported $361K in total revenue in fiscal year 2020. Revenue fell 85% from the prior year — a significant decline worth monitoring. Expenses of $1.3M exceeded revenue, resulting in a 267% operating deficit.

Mission

Funding research that will be used to develop effective public health solutions for the prevention and mitigation of firearm related victimization, injury and death.
